For a mini intro, the line launched exclusively at Bergdorfs and select Neiman Marcus locations last October 2008 and most of the products are available for purchase online at Neiman Marcus and Bergdorf Goodman. The line may be available at few boutique salons and recently launched in the UK at Libertys. Be prepared to see price points similar to that of Dolce & Gabbana (see previous D&G feature here) and Giorgio Armani products.

Last fall (around September/October 2008) Bobbi Brown discontinued her Lipshimmer Lipsticks and came out with a new formula of shimmer lipsticks, her Metallic Lip Colors. She kept a few of her best-selling shades, but discontinued the rest and released new colors. However, the ones she did keep are slightly different than the originals – just as pretty, but better.
“Metallic Lip Color features a unique combination of high-shine emollients and light-reflective pearls. This creamy lipstick feels soft and comfortable on lips, and offers medium coverage.”
They are in fact creamier in texture than her original Lipshimmers (which were on the dry-side) and offers a true medium coverage. The only downside to the soft texture is that it makes them prone to breakage (2 of mine have broken already). But the colors and textures are lovely and I find that these are one of the few lipsticks I find pretty enough to wear alone without liner or gloss added. These currently retail for $22 USD.
